Add 6/42 and 1/48
6/42 + 1/48 is 55/336.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 42 and 48 is 336
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 336 - For the 1st fraction, since 42 × 8 = 336,
6/42 = 6 × 8/42 × 8 = 48/336 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 48 × 7 = 336,
1/48 = 1 × 7/48 × 7 = 7/336 - Add the two like fractions:
48/336 + 7/336 = 48 + 7/336 = 55/336 - So, 6/42 + 1/48 = 55/336
